Online Audio Ads

Streaming audio advertisements can be programmatically inserted into a range of content types on audio platforms like Spotify and Pandora. These ads can be used to engage and captivate listeners in a variety of ways, including pre-rolling, mid-rolling, or postroll.

These audio ads are also able to track ad engagement and general demographics, including age, gender, and genre. Additionally, most audio ads will also contain an incentive or promo code that will entice listeners to purchase from a brand's website.

Statistics

  • Google will display whichever ad type (CPM or CPC) is expected to earn more revenue for the publisher, which is in Google's best interest since they take a 32% share of the revenue. (quicksprout.com)
  • Nonetheless, advertising spending as a share of GDP was slightly lower – about 2.4 percent. (en.wikipedia.org)
  • Advertising's projected distribution for 2017 was 40.4% on TV, 33.3% on digital, 9% on newspapers, 6.9% on magazines, 5.8% outdoor, and 4.3% on radio. (en.wikipedia.org)
  • In 1919 it was 2.5 percent of gross domestic product (GDP) in the US, and it averaged 2.2 percent of GDP between then and at least 2007, though it may have declined dramatically since the Great Recession. (en.wikipedia.org)
